2014-05-14 6 views
1

업데이트 후에 시작되지 않음,이 오류 Server TC7 failed to start을 얻을 다음과 같은 메시지가 콘솔에서 변 :이 일어 났일식 STS - TC 서버 인스턴스 내가 STS에서 TC 서버를 시작할 때 STS는

Error opening zip file or JAR manifest missing : /usr/local/springsource/sts-3.2.0.RELEASE/configuration/org.eclipse.osgi/bundles/960/1/.cp/lib/springloaded-1.1.0.jar 
Error occurred during initialization of VM 
agent library failed to init: instrument 

마지막 몇 번 일식 내에서 STS를 업데이트했습니다. 무엇이 잘못 될 수 있으며 어떻게 수정합니까?

답변

3

STS 'Servers보기에서 서버를 마우스 오른쪽 단추로 클릭하고 Properties를여십시오. 위치 전환을 클릭하고 원래 위치로 돌아가려면 다시 클릭 한 다음 적용을 클릭하고 서버를 다시 시작하십시오 (이클립스를 다시 시작해야 할 수도 있음). 모든 것이 이제는 효과가있다.

문제의 원인은 STS를 업데이트 한 후에 Tomcat을 계측하는 데 사용되는 spring-loaded의 새로운 위치가 이전 tc Server의 구성에 알려지지 않았기 때문입니다. 백그라운드에서 tc Server는 시작 구성 (서버> 열기> 열기 실행> 인수 탭)에서 볼 수있는 다양한 명령 줄 매개 변수로 시작되며 업데이트 할 때 오래된 버전입니다. 작업 영역을 전환하면 STS는 업데이트 된 값을 사용하여 작업 영역을 자동으로 다시 설정합니다. 어떤 이유로 STS를 업데이트 할 때 자동으로이 작업을 수행하지 않습니다.